Wang Zhijian Meets with Karaganda Region Governor Bulekpayev of Kazakhstan and Witnesses Signing

2025.12.10

On December 10, Wang Zhijian, Party Secretary and Chairman of Shandong Heavy Industry Group, met in Jinan with Yermaganbet Bulekpayev, Governor of Kazakhstan’s Karaganda Region, who is visiting China. The two sides held in-depth talks on advancing the start-up and operation of the joint venture plant and other matters, and witnessed a signing ceremony.

The signing was witnessed by Governor Bulekpayev, Wang Zhijian, Bolat Ussenov, Counselor of the Embassy of Kazakhstan in China, and Liu Zhengtao, Party Secretary and Chairman of China National Heavy Duty Truck Group (SINOTRUK). Cui Alexander Levmirovich, business representative of Saran Machinery LLC, and Zhao Hua, Deputy General Manager of SINOTRUK, signed the agreement on behalf of the two parties.

Wang welcomed the delegation from the Karaganda regional government and enterprises, and expressed sincere appreciation for the strong support provided by Kazakhstan’s governments at all levels for Shandong Heavy Industry and SINOTRUK’s localization project. He noted that the construction and completion of the joint venture plant represent a major milestone in deepening strategic mutual trust and expanding practical cooperation. The signing is an important step in advancing the Group’s strategy of localized manufacturing, localized R&D and localized services, and carries far-reaching strategic significance for promoting coordinated development of the equipment manufacturing industry in both countries. Noting the solid foundation and broad prospects for cooperation, he expressed hope that the parties will build on existing projects to further expand cooperation in assemblies, components and parts, agricultural equipment, construction machinery and other fields, and create a new model of deep integration across the entire industrial chain.

Governor Bulekpayev thanked Sinotruk for its warm reception. He said Karaganda, as a key industrial base in Kazakhstan, has always regarded cooperation with SINOTRUK as an important engine for high-quality regional economic development. He added that the signing marks a new starting point for deeper cooperation. The Karaganda regional government will continue to build an open and efficient cooperation platform, fully leverage local talent strengths, and provide comprehensive support in joint talent development, spare parts supply assurance and project financing, so as to accelerate implementation and ensure that the outcomes of cooperation deliver tangible benefits to local economic development and public well-being.
